This Crochet Owl Super Scarf will make a great addition to your wardrobe. This pattern will give you a scarf that’s 100 inches long by 8 inches wide. The tutorial is really well laid out with photos and detailed instructions and tips for each step.

In the video, you will also learn how to make the Owl Pom-Pom Feet. The pattern starts off with a simple Crochet Owl and then moves on to a V-Stitch Pattern. It’s made with Chunky Yarns and works up quickly. This Crochet Owl Scarf would also make a lovely gift for friends and family.
What You Need For Owl Scarf Project
- 5 Skeins of Emerald Yarn, 2 of Seagreen Yarn, 1 of Natural for featured color scheme
- 1 Skein of Gold Yarn
- 1/2 skein of White Yarn for the Owl Eyes
- 2 Black Buttons
- Crochet Hook Size H
- Large Tapestry Needle

The Crochet Owl Super Scarf is made as two halves and then stitched together. Start off with the Natural Yarn in a Magic Ring. The stitches used are Chain, SC Single Crochet and DC -Double Crochet.
The color pattern used is 2 rows of Sea Green Yarn, 1 row Natural and 7 rows of Emerald. This is repeated 5.5 times. Be sure to end after 3 rows of Emerald on one scarf half, and 4 rows of Emerald on the 2nd piece of the scarf so that it will look seamless when you stitch it together with your tapestry needle.
